- Abstract: This review manuscript highlights the tribological and mechanical characteristics of aluminium based metal-matrix composites (MMCs) reinforced with micro/nano-sized ceramic-particulates, across various operating parameters like normal load (N), sliding velocity (m/s), sliding distance (m), temperature (°C), reinforcement weight percentage, etc. Such advanced composites find frequent applications in automotives, military, marine, structural, etc. Hence components life has to be improved by enhancing their mechanical and tribological properties in a cost-effective manner in order to improve the overall efficiency of manufacturing sector. The literature review concluded that ceramic particulate reinforcement lead to significant enhancement of mechanical and tribological characteristics of Al alloy composites.
